| Taking the
Fifth |
|
Common parlance for exerting the right
against self incrimination in a criminal proceeding, as set out in
the Fifth Amendment to the U.S. Constitution |

| Tenancy |
|
The right of a tenant to possess property
either by lease or by title. |
|
|
|
|
|
|
| Tenancy by the
Entireties |
|
Joint possession of real property by a
husband and wife who are viewed as one entity under the law. Neither
husband nor wife and convey the property without the consent of the
other, and the surviving spouse takes control of the entire
estate. |
|
|
|
|
|
|
| Tenancy in
Common |
|
Possession of real property by two or more
persons in equal or unequal shares with each person having the right
to enjoy the property but no right of survivorship. |
|
|
|
|
|
|
| Testator/Testatrix |
|
The person who makes and executes a will or
testament. |

| Testimony |
|
Statements made under oath. |
|
|
|
|
|
|
| Title |
|
Ownership in property including use and
possession of the property; written proof of ownership in
property. |
|
|
|
|
|
|
| Title Search |
|
The process of determining the chain of
title in a piece of real property including all encumbrances, liens,
and mortgages. |
|
|
|
|
|
|
| Tort |
|
The breach of a duty that results in an
injury for which there is a remedy at law. |
|
|
|
|
|
|
| Trademark |
|
A word or symbol used to distinguish one
corporate product from another. Trademarks are used to protect the
genuineness of a product and if they qualify they can be registered
with the U.S. Patent and Trademark Office. |

| Trial |
|
The adversarial process or resolving
disputes either civil or criminal whereby evidence is presented
before a judicial body in relation to existing law and a resolution
is reached. |
|
|
|
|
|
|
| Trust |
|
A property interest held secure for a third
person beneficiary by a trustee at the request of another person,
the settlor. |
|
|
|
|
|
|
| Trust
Company |
|
A corporation engaged in the business of
serving as a trustee. |
|
|
|
|
|
|
| Trust Fund |
|
The property held by a trustee for the
benefit of a third party beneficiary. |
|
|
|
|
|
|
| Trustee |
|
A person or corporation who holds legal
title to property in a trust for the benefit of a third party
beneficiary and a fiduciary duty to that
beneficiary. |
